The old tree behind the house was cursed. Its bark split like veins, and thick black sap oozed from the cracks.

When it rained, the roots would hum, a low, wet sound that made the earth tremble. We cut it down last year. Burned it. Buried the ashes.

Tonight, something stands in its place.
What happens next?

They said the dolls were harmless. Pretty little things with glass eyes and painted smiles.

But every night, I hear the clinking of porcelain from the nursery. Tiny footsteps tapping across the floorboards. Whispered giggles behind the door.

This morning, I found a new place set at the table—
a cup of tea already poured, still warm.

And my name stitched neatly into a doll’s silk dress.

Would you join their tea party?
